New and/or Improved Features in AutoCAD 2022: Installer-The new Installer reduces the number of steps required for the initial install, improving performance. Floating Drawing Tabs-Drag a drawing file tab from the main application window to make it a separate drawing file window and have several drawings open at once. This is particularly useful if you have two or more monitors. Shared Views-Store your designs in the Cloud for other users to view, measure, and exchange feedback. Share Current Drawing-Share a link to your drawing file and others can view or edit that drawing in AutoCAD's online application. Trace-Turn this on so that collaborators can work together on drawing changes without altering the existing drawing. Redesigned Start Tab-Take advantage of easier access to recent work and saved drawing files from connected drives, as well as learning resources and announcements from Autodesk.
